Actually, end token does have an XmlLineBookmark now – it’s a recent addition so if you’re using the binary dist you won’t have that. Since there is memory overhead, bookmarks at end element need to be explicitly enabled via xml options: setLoadLineNumbers(XmlOptions.LOAD_LINE_NUMBERS_END_ELEMENT);
